Summary

CVE-2023-41976 is a high-severity Use After Free (CWE-416) vulnerability in Apple Ipados. Its CVSS base score is 8.8 (High).

Operationally, ranked in the top 49.8% of CVEs by exploit likelihood; it is not currently listed in the CISA KEV catalog.

Vulnerability details

A use-after-free issue was addressed with improved memory management. This issue is fixed in iOS 17.1 and iPadOS 17.1, watchOS 10.1, iOS 16.7.2 and iPadOS 16.7.2, macOS Sonoma 14.1, Safari 17.1, tvOS 17.1. Processing web content may lead to arbitrary…

more

code execution.
